MCS began over 40 years ago in the UK with a clear mission — to make life simpler for rental businesses. Founded by experts who understood the challenges of managing equipment, contracts, and customers, MCS set out to create reliable software that would bring control, visibility, and professionalism to the rental industry.
Over the decades, MCS grew from a small local provider into a global leader in rental software, now supporting thousands of rental experts across 35+ countries. The company’s success has always been driven by close collaboration with clients, listening carefully to their needs, and continuously improving the software to match the evolving rental landscape.
Today, MCS remains independently owned and innovation‑focused, combining deep industry knowledge with modern cloud technology and AI‑enhanced intelligence. The result is a software platform that empowers rental businesses to work smarter, stay sustainable, and grow without limits - staying true to the founding vision of supporting customer success through trusted, forward‑thinking solutions.
